Silica sulfuric acid/ethylene glycol as an efficient catalyst for the synthesis of benzo[4,5]imidazo[1,2-a]pyrimidine-3-carbonitrile derivatives

, , , &
Pages 3112-3120 | Received 19 Feb 2019, Published online: 05 Sep 2019
 

Abstract

A simple and efficient eco-friendly method was developed for the synthesis of new benzo[4,5]imidazo[1,2-a]pyrimidine-3-carbonitrile derivatives in excellent yields. The synthesis was achieved through the reaction of 2-aminobenzimidazole, aldehydes and active nitriles (malononitrle or ethyl cyanoacetae) in the presence of silica sulfuric acid/ethylene glycol. This protocol offers very short reaction times (in some cases, reaction times were reduced to five minutes), high yields and low cost. This method thus provides an improvement over the existing methods.
